What Does a Vedic Ritual Consultation Actually Cover?
A Vedic Ritual Consultation goes far beyond choosing a wedding date. A qualified pandit examines both horoscopes for compatibility (gun milan or ashtakoota), identifies favourable lunar tithi and nakshatra combinations, and determines precise muhurat timings for each sub-ritual — from ashirbad and gaye holud to saptapadi and sindoor daan. The pandit also outlines every ritual step in sequence, explains their symbolic meaning, and provides a complete puja samagri arrangement list so families can source items without confusion. For non-Bengali rituals such as North Indian or South Indian ceremonies performed in Kolkata, the consultant cross-references regional scriptural variations. A thorough consultation prevents clashes between simultaneous sub-rituals, eliminates superstition-driven panic, and ensures the ceremony flows with dignity. How Much Does a Vedic Ritual Consultation Cost in Kolkata?
Pricing for a Vedic Ritual Consultation in Kolkata varies based on the pandit's experience, the length of the session, and the ceremony type. A basic 60-minute online session for muhurat selection starts at around INR 1,500. An in-person consultation covering full Hindu ceremony planning — including horoscope matching, ritual sequencing, samagri list, and dress code guidance — typically ranges from INR 3,000 to INR 6,000. For complex ceremonies like annaprashan, upanayana, or multi-day Bengali weddings, comprehensive sacred ritual guidance packages can go up to INR 8,000–INR 12,000. Some pandits bundle the consultation fee into their overall dakshina for performing the ceremony, which can offer better value. Bengali Wedding Traditions and the Role of Ritual Planning
Bengali wedding traditions are among the most visually rich and ritually layered in India. Ceremonies typically span two to three days and include ashirbad, aiburo bhaat, gaye holud, shubho drishti, mala badal, saptapadi, sindoor daan, and bou bhaat. Each sub-ritual has specific timing requirements, directional rules (the groom must not face south during certain rites), and ingredient lists. Without proper Hindu ceremony planning, families often discover mid-ceremony that a specific item — say, shiuli flowers for the shubho drishti or a specific wood for the sacred fire — is missing. A Vedic Ritual Consultation addresses these gaps in advance. The consultant also advises on auspicious date booking aligned with the Bengali Panjika (almanac), ensuring the chosen dates carry genuine Vedic sanction and not just calendar convenience. How to Choose the Right Option
✅ Pre-booking Checklist
- Gather both horoscopes with exact birth time, date, and place before the consultation
- Confirm your family gotra and kula devata details to share with the pandit
- Prepare a list of all ceremonies you need planned (wedding, pre-wedding, post-wedding)
- Fix a preferred date range and venue location before the session to save time
- Ask the pandit to provide a written ritual sequence and samagri list after the session
- Verify the pandit's familiarity with your specific regional tradition (Bengali, Marwari, etc.)
- Clarify whether the consultation fee is separate from the ceremony performance dakshina
- Book at least 3–6 months in advance for popular wedding season dates (November–February)
🎯 Selection Criteria
- Pandit's knowledge of your specific Vedic school (Rigveda, Samaveda, Atharvaveda)
- Experience with the exact ceremony type you are planning in Kolkata
- Ability to explain rituals in Bengali, Hindi, or English as needed by your family
- Transparency in pricing with no hidden charges for additional follow-up questions
- Availability to attend the ceremony on the confirmed date, if booking a bundled package
- Familiarity with local puja samagri sources in Kolkata for accurate budgeting guidance
💰 Cost / Quality Factors
- Ceremony complexity: multi-day weddings cost more to plan than single-event pujas
- Pandit seniority and academic credentials in Vedic studies or Jyotish
- Session format: in-person sessions cost more than online consultations
- Number of sub-rituals requiring individual muhurat calculations
- Travel charges if pandit needs to visit your Kolkata venue for assessment
- Bundling discounts available when combining consultation with ceremony performance
⚠️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Skipping horoscope review and relying solely on a convenient calendar date
- Booking a pandit unfamiliar with Bengali Panjika for a Bengali wedding ceremony
- Delaying consultation to the last month, leaving no time to source rare samagri items
- Not confirming the ritual sequence in writing, leading to day-of confusion
- Assuming all Vedic pandits follow the same ritual tradition regardless of region
- Overlooking the need for a separate consultation when adding a new sub-ceremony post-booking
